I've started the 2nd prototype wheelhouse extension (and dismantled the first). We had proved the concept but wanted the central fixed part a little narrower. The goals are a full cockpit enclosure AND moving the mainsheet from the top of the aft cabin to above the wheelhouse (better safety and a better sheeting angle). We also refitted the timber trim on the port side complete with the front zip for the first removable window section. When we bought Vida in August 2019 she was in a very tired and damp condition with all original equipment and fittings (much of it not working). We have removed all the gas, diesel and paraffin equipment, and are installing all-electric (motor, cooking etc). Giorno 63 - l’arrivo a Cadice Cavolo si sente.. e pensare che è acqua! Acqua salata di qua e acqua salata di là… Eppure cambia! Sicuramente cambiano i ridossi, i fondali, le masse d’acqua che si spostano. Per esempio ci siamo accorti subito che un basso fondale non è solo una secca da aggirare, ma un generatore di onde! Avere la massa dell’oceano che si scontra su un fondale che sale crea onde nervose, secche. Come un ribollire arrabbiato. Tendenzialmente comunque è tutto più lento. Sali sali sali e sceeeendi. La velocità della barca è notevolmente superiore, altro fattore più incisivo è la corrente! Che meraviglia.
